Selecting the Right Music for Your Ad
Selecting advertising music requires understanding your target audience, brand identity, and the campaign’s message. The music should:
- Reflect the tone – energetic, mellow, serious, or light-hearted, depending on the ad’s style.
- Represent your brand’s character – traditional, modern, innovative, or trustworthy.
- Suit the cultural context – ensuring it appeals to your market.
- Support the narrative – making the ad more engaging.
Choosing Between Original and Licensed Tracks
You can opt for custom music or pre-existing songs. Original music offers exclusivity and uniqueness, but can be more expensive and time-consuming. Licensed music offers variety and familiarity but requires licensing rights.

Music Licensing Tips
Proper copyright clearance is a must to ensure compliance. This includes rights to pair music with visuals, public performance rights, and mechanical rights, depending on where and how the emotional advertising music ad is shown.
